Dave wrote 8< My favourite example of "other ways to worship besides
singing" is staff-leaning. "By faith Jacob, when he was dying, blessed each
of Joseph's sons, and worshiped as he leaned on the top of his staff." Heb.
11:21, NIV 8<
Extra credit: why did Jacob need to lean on a staff? Why is that posture
important to the author of Hebrews?
Buzzzz!
Jacob leaned on his staff because of the wound inflicted when he "wrestled
with a man" (Gen 32:24-30). Perhaps the author is reminding us that the
heart of Jacob's worship was in his recognition of God's power over him. On
the one hand he knew he could not prevail, but on the other, he would not
let go until God blessed him. Father, may we refuse to let go in our
wrestling with You, and may we be touched by Your power, even if it wounds
us.
